Yuki Takei 4 лет назад
Родитель
Сommit
214994af9a

+ 1 - 1
packages/app/src/components/SearchPage/SearchControl.tsx

@@ -61,7 +61,7 @@ const SearchControl: FC <Props> = React.memo((props: Props) => {
   }, [invokeSearch]);
 
   return (
-    <div className="position-sticky fixed-top shadow-sm">
+    <div className="position-sticky sticky-top shadow-sm">
       <div className="grw-search-page-nav d-flex py-3 align-items-center">
         <div className="flex-grow-1 mx-4">
           <SearchForm

+ 1 - 1
packages/app/src/styles/_navbar.scss

@@ -1,7 +1,7 @@
 .grw-navbar {
   top: -$grw-navbar-height !important;
 
-  z-index: $grw-navbar-z-index-amount !important; // should be higher than SubNavigation
+  z-index: $grw-navbar-z-index !important;
   max-height: $grw-navbar-height + $grw-navbar-border-width;
   border-top: 0;
   border-right: 0;

+ 3 - 4
packages/app/src/styles/_variables.scss

@@ -15,6 +15,9 @@ $font-family-monospace-not-strictly: Monaco, Menlo, Consolas, 'Courier New', Mei
 //== Layout
 $grw-navbar-height: 52px;
 $grw-navbar-border-width: 3.3333px;
+// slightly larger than $zindex-sticky
+// https://getbootstrap.jp/docs/4.5/layout/overview/#z-index
+$grw-navbar-z-index: 1025;
 
 $grw-subnav-min-height: 95px;
 $grw-subnav-min-height-md: 115px;
@@ -36,7 +39,3 @@ $grw-logomark-width: 36px;
 $grw-nav-main-left-tab-width: 95px;
 $grw-nav-main-left-tab-width-mobile: 50px;
 $grw-nav-main-tab-height: 42px;
-
-// slightly larger than $zindex-fixed
-// https://getbootstrap.jp/docs/4.5/layout/overview/#z-index
-$grw-navbar-z-index-amount: 1035;